When Orson Welles first met with Dennis Weaver, he asked Weaver what he thought was the most important characteristic of "Chester," the role Weaver played on the hit TV show Gunsmoke (1955). Weaver said that Chester was very deferential and always hung behind the other characters. Welles then told Weaver that for L'infernale Quinlan (1958) he wanted Weaver to be just the opposite - very pushy and in-your-face.
